I agree to a point. I think that line falls right on when/how you allow kids to make decisions for themselves... You see too many parents who take the attitude that kids will do what kids want to do and as a parent I have no right to make decisions for them, even when they are little... I think most would agree that is a flawed theory.. you have to guide a kids decision making process as they grow and learn, giving them more and more decision making responsibility and freedom as they prove they can handle it.... the flip side to that is the parents who NEVER allow their kids to make a decision for fear that they will make a bad one, even a simple one like what to wear or what games to play... another flawed theory because then your kids never learn to make their own decisions, their own mistakes, and they never get the learning process that goes with that....

Kids need to be taught how to make good decisions, how to think through the consequences of those decisions ahead of time, and how to be accountable for the decisions they make should they go bad.... it starts with simple things when they're little and grows as their own maturity grows....
